Why Pursue a Career as a Home Health Aide in Coffeyville, KS?
Typically a home health aide (HHA) provides caregiving services that enable individuals to remain in their home as opposed to being taken care of in a medical facility. HHA’s supply basic caregiving services which include monitoring a patients’ vital signs and medication schedule, cooking meals, personal grooming, light cleaning, and companionship. It can be a demanding career, and as a result the turnover can be high. So why would you want to go after such a career?

Six reasons why this job may be perfect for you.
Job Growth
As baby boomers age, it is anticipated that increasingly more elderly are going to choose to stay in their own homes as long as they can. This is increasing demand for caregivers to provide services in household settings, assisted living facilities, as well as adult day care programs. The U.S. Department of Labor’s Bureau of Labor Statistics rates the job outlook for home health aides as “excellent.” In truth, it’s the second-fastest growing vocation in the U.S. (following that of registered nurses). Careerinfonet.org predicts job openings for Home Health Aides will grow by 69% which is over 700,000 more jobs dueing the 10 year period 2010 to 2020.
Flexible Schedule
Home health aides perform tasks which are needed on several different schedules. This means you are often allowed the option for a flexible or non-traditional work schedule. For instance, you could visit a patient in their home daily, weekly, or on some other schedule. You might also opt to work overnight shifts for clients who require overnight monitoring. Home health aides in Coffeyville, KS can easily work part-time or full-time. This comes in handy if you are searching for a career that will allow you to satisfy child care obligations, continuing education, or any additional responsibilities.
Employer Variety
Being a home health aide means you will have various employment routes available to you based upon your work preferences. HHAs are hired by home health care agencies, adult day care programs, non-profit organizations, assisted living facilities, and private parties (families). You’ll see a different degree of benefits, assistance, and job environment based upon the kind of employer. A number of caregivers choose to be self-employed and do private-duty work in order to have more control over their careers and clients.
Entry Career to Additional Healthcare Professions
For anyone who is contemplating a healthcare career, training to be a home health aide is a good entry point. This allows you to gain experience in the field, and even to continue working, while you pursue becoming a CNA, LPN, registered nurse, or any other career in the medical field.
